    A surprisingly delicious meal! Just wasn't expecting that from this hotel poolside bar. LOCATION & DECOR: Poolside at the Sheraton. Bring a room key to enter that area although there is usually one door open. FOOD & DRINK: A few major label beers. Corona, blue moon, some IPA. PRICE: $$ $16- Fish n Chips $22- 14 inch Buffalo chicken pizza SWAG/AMENITIES: Couple of hot tubs surrounding the pool on opposite sides. One where the adults play and one for the kiddos, thank God. Nothing worse than kids splashing in a hot tub. Games around there pool side area--big chess and corn hole among others. STAFF & EXPERIENCE: We were welcomed in with joyous greetings. We arrived before our room was ready, but were able to get our bags held up front while we went to the poolside bar. We were waited on hand and foot. Never waited too long for food. Proportions were great. There was sports on the TV. Noise level was average. Overall, I'd eat here again.

    It's the one bar and restaurant option at the Sheraton Orlando Resort Lake Buena Vista, outside of the breakfast buffet and in-hotel convenience market. We ate and drank here on several different days as we frolicked around in the pools which are in the center of the four hotel buildings -- makes a perfect common hangout spot. Service-- on point. Everyone at this hotel is super friendly and attentive; front desk staff are fast friends, housekeepers are very customer service oriented, and the 27 Palms team are no different. You're never kept waiting for food, drinks, or tabs; they are amply staffed and work well as a team to make sure that even when there is a small crowd, you sure feel like you are their #1 customer. Any time we would order anything that needed prep and we're obviously ready to wander off anywhere else, they'd happily bring whatever it was to wherever we were. Ambiance-- it's a 20+ seat wraparound pool bar with plenty of room, four TV's that are kept at just the perfect volume that you can quietly hear them but they're never intrusive, and you're surrounded by two pools and two hot tubs. 27 palm trees are in evidence. Food-- Very reasonable prices and selection for this caliber of resort hotel. The food they do have comes out quickly and everything we had was fine. Mostly burgers and fried foods, though they do have some other items on the menu, too. Drinks-- Great selection for a pool bar, good pours and prices.
